The National Forum on Youth Violence Prevention, an interagency initiative led by the Justice and Education departments, held a two-day forum on preventing youth violence. The opening session included remarks by White House Senior Adviser Valerie Jarrett and members of Congress. Officials from six cities around the country gave presentations on their programs to help reduce youth and gang violence. close
